简体中文简体中文
EnglishEnglish
简体中文简体中文

音乐上传源码揭秘:打造个性化音乐分享平台的关键技

2025-01-20 17:21:10

随着互联网技术的飞速发展,音乐分享已经成为人们日常生活中不可或缺的一部分。音乐上传源码作为音乐分享平台的核心技术,其重要性不言而喻。本文将深入探讨音乐上传源码的原理、应用以及如何打造一个高效、安全的音乐分享平台。

一、音乐上传源码概述

音乐上传源码是指实现音乐上传功能的代码集合,主要包括前端界面、后端服务器以及数据库等组成部分。用户通过前端界面上传音乐文件,后端服务器接收文件并进行处理,最终将音乐信息存储到数据库中。以下是音乐上传源码的主要功能:

1.文件上传:支持多种音乐格式上传,如MP3、WAV、AAC等。

2.文件存储:将上传的音乐文件存储在服务器上,方便用户下载和分享。

3.数据处理:对上传的音乐文件进行格式转换、压缩等处理,提高存储空间利用率。

4.数据库存储:将音乐信息存储到数据库中,包括歌曲名称、歌手、专辑、时长等。

5.用户权限管理:实现用户注册、登录、上传、下载等功能,保障平台安全。

二、音乐上传源码应用

1.音乐分享平台:通过音乐上传源码,用户可以轻松上传自己喜欢的音乐,与其他用户分享,实现音乐资源的共享。

2.音乐播放器:结合音乐上传源码,打造一个具有音乐上传、播放、下载等功能的音乐播放器,满足用户个性化需求。

3.音乐制作工具:音乐上传源码可以为音乐制作人提供方便的音乐存储和分享功能,提高工作效率。

4.音乐版权管理:通过音乐上传源码,实现对音乐版权的追踪和管理,保障版权方的合法权益。

三、打造个性化音乐分享平台的关键技术

1.前端技术:采用HTML5、CSS3、JavaScript等技术,实现美观、易用的音乐上传界面。

2.后端技术:选用Python、Java、PHP等后端开发语言,构建稳定、高效的服务器。

3.数据库技术:使用MySQL、MongoDB等数据库,实现音乐信息的存储和管理。

4.文件存储技术:采用分布式文件存储系统,如HDFS、Ceph等,提高文件存储的可靠性和扩展性。

5.安全技术:采用HTTPS、SSL等加密技术,保障用户上传和下载音乐的安全性。

6.搜索引擎优化:通过SEO技术,提高音乐分享平台的搜索排名,吸引更多用户。

7.社交分享功能:集成微信、微博等社交平台,实现音乐分享的快速传播。

8.个性化推荐:根据用户喜好,推荐相似音乐,提高用户活跃度。

总结:

音乐上传源码作为音乐分享平台的核心技术,对于打造一个高效、安全的音乐分享平台具有重要意义。通过掌握音乐上传源码的相关技术,我们可以为用户提供更好的音乐体验,推动音乐产业的发展。在未来,随着技术的不断创新,音乐上传源码将在音乐分享领域发挥更大的作用。